  1. My buddy just bought an 86 xt turbo. The owner said it needed a new alternator. We hooked the car up to my battery w/ jumper cables and it fired up to see if it ran well, it started first try, but as soon as we unhooked the car from my battery it sputtered out and died. We tried giving it some gas to see if we could keep it running w/out jumpers. This caused a power surge that seemed to turn on all of the electrical components, e.g. wipers, head lights, dash brightened, it was crazy. Anyways he put a new alternator in it and it won't start now. A fuse labeled engine control, or something like that, burns out every time the key is turned into the "on" position. Car is getting spark. Any ideas? thanks

  6. Hey everyone, i have got a problem that maybe you could help me figure out. I just installed and intercooler and manual boost controller on my 86 xt turbo. I turned the boost to 9-10 and I gave it a try. The thing is way faster but quickly I ran into a problem. When I give it a lot of gas and it reaches full boost after a second of fast acceleration the power suddenly cuts out, feels like a major hose was blown off or something, but then it returns to idle and is completely normal, no loose hose fittings. Boost gauge and air/fuel gauge read nothing out of the ordinary. Am I somehow reaching the fuel cut limit? I know people are running more boost than this without problems, any ideas? thanks a lot
